Check this interesting article by CMAJ HIVST should be integrated within provincial HIV testing programs and in service delivery models that are centred on self-testers, and that involve pharmacies, online or smartphone-based applications, vending machines or community-based organizations. https://www.cmaj.ca/content/192/44/E1367

"How well does daily oral PrEP work for people who share drug injection equipment? ... HIV risk was reduced by 84% among people who used tenofovir consistently compared to those who did not. " More info on @catieinfo‘s site.
